Abstract Cruise M121 was dedicated to the investigation of the distribution of dissolved and particulate trace metals and their isotopic compositions (TEIs) in the full water column of the Angola Basin and the northernmost Cape Basin. During the whole cruise two vessel mounted Acoustic Doppler Current Profiler (VMADCP), the 75kHz RDI Ocean Surveyor and the 38kHz RDI Ocean Surveyor were used. The 75kHz ADCP lost velocity data. The 12kHz echosounder EM122 was in use during the entire cruise and delivered high quality bathymetry data without noticeable interference. To record multibeam data was not the main focus of the cruise and no further informations have been provided by the responsible party.
